Figma SWOT Analysis

Updated: October 3, 2025 • 2025-Q4 Analysis

The Figma SWOT Analysis reveals a company at a pivotal moment of strength and opportunity. Its market dominance, beloved brand, and unparalleled collaboration engine provide a formidable foundation. However, performance bottlenecks and feature gaps in the enterprise space represent critical weaknesses that competitors could exploit. The primary strategic imperative is to leverage its massive user base and workflow integration to win the AI race, transforming the platform from a design tool into an intelligent creation engine. Simultaneously, Figma must aggressively expand its canvas to adjacent markets and harden its enterprise offering with enhanced security and performance. This dual focus—innovating with AI while fortifying the core platform for large-scale deployment—is essential to neutralize threats from both nimble AI startups and bundled incumbents. The path to fulfilling its vision as the universal canvas for creation requires balancing expansive ambition with operational excellence.

Strengths

  • DOMINANCE: Uncontested UI/UX leader with >80% market share and deep moat.
  • COLLABORATION: Gold-standard real-time engine drives powerful network effects.
  • ECOSYSTEM: Massive community plugin and file library creates high value/lock-in.
  • BRAND: Deeply loved by designers for its user-centric focus and simplicity.
  • DEVELOPER: Dev Mode and integrations successfully bridge the design-dev gap.

Weaknesses

  • PERFORMANCE: Large, complex files continue to suffer from significant browser lag.
  • PRICING: New paid features like Dev Mode are creating adoption friction.
  • OFFLINE: Limited offline functionality remains a critical gap for many users.
  • VERTICALS: The core product is not yet optimized for non-design use cases.
  • ENTERPRISE: Security and admin features still lag behind Adobe/Microsoft suites.

Opportunities

  • AI: Generative AI can automate tedious tasks and unlock new creative workflows.
  • EXPANSION: High potential to move into adjacent markets like presentations/docs.
  • PLATFORM: Become the central system of record for all product development teams.
  • ENTERPRISE: Post-Adobe deal, large companies are more eager to adopt Figma.
  • EDUCATION: Solidify long-term dominance by embedding Figma into curriculums.

Threats

  • COMPETITION: Canva moving upmarket; Adobe's renewed focus on its own tools.
  • DISRUPTION: New, AI-native tools could make traditional design workflows obsolete.
  • BUNDLING: Microsoft/Google could bundle 'good enough' design tools for free.
  • REGULATION: Increased antitrust scrutiny due to clear market dominance.
  • COMMODITIZATION: AI automating design principles could devalue the core tool.

Key Priorities

  • AI-INTEGRATION: Weave AI into the core workflow to boost user productivity.
  • PLATFORM-EXPANSION: Expand into adjacent creative markets beyond core UI/UX.
  • ENTERPRISE-READINESS: Double down on performance, security, and admin features.
  • ECOSYSTEM-LEVERAGE: Monetize and promote the community plugin ecosystem.

Figma Competitive Forces

Threat of New Entry

Low. Building a comparable real-time engine and cultivating a massive community ecosystem would require immense capital and years of effort.

Supplier Power

Low. Primary suppliers are cloud providers like AWS, which is a commoditized market with high competition, giving Figma leverage.

Buyer Power

Moderate. Individual users have low power, but large enterprise customers (e.g., Microsoft) can negotiate significant discounts and terms.

Threat of Substitution

Moderate. Substitutes include not just other design tools but also new AI-native platforms that could fragment the workflow entirely.

Competitive Rivalry

Moderate. While Figma dominates UI/UX, Canva is a threat in broader design, and Adobe remains a powerful, albeit slower, competitor.
